Abstract
The electronic states of the unsaturated organometallic carbene CrCH2+ are investigated using high-resolution translational energy loss spectroscopy. The observed energy loss feature (1.05 ±0.2 eV) is in good agreement with theoretical calculations which predict two higher lying states, 6B1, and 6A1 at 0.78 and 0.82 eV respectively, above the 4B1 ground state of CrCH2+.
